Author Nevin Gussack details the communist strategy behind the manipulation of American conservatives, libertarians, and Republicans. Sowing the Seeds of Our Destruction is the first comprehensive and devastating treatment of how powerful elements of the American "conservative" and libertarian movements provided intellectual support to Russia, Red China, and other communist countries. The splits within the conservative movement and Republican Party over the na ve and appeasement-minded approach to the USSR and Red China are covered at length. American big business also played an immense role in the lobbying campaign on behalf of the Soviet Union, Putin's Russia, Red China, and Vietnam. The actions of the US-USSR Trade and Economic Council, the US Chamber of Commerce, and other like-minded corporate globalist entities are fully documented in this book. Nevin Gussack is a professional librarian, political commentator, and writer. His works appeared on the webpages of the Center for Intelligence Studies, Accuracy in Media, Economy in Crisis, and JRNyquist.com. He also appeared on America's Survival Roku television program, WEI's Make the Call radio program, and the veteran broadcaster Chuck Harder's radio program For the People. Nevin received a double major from the State University of New York at Albany in History and Political Science. Since that time, he also received two Master's Degrees in Social Studies Education from Florida Atlantic University and Library and Information Science from the University of South Florida. A native of New York, Nevin lives with his wife, daughter, and eight cheerful, chirping birds in Florida.
